
Python设置Linux系统的步骤包括:安装Python、配置环境变量、安装必备库、设置虚拟环境、创建和管理Python脚本。 其中,安装Python 是第一步且最为重要,因为它是后续所有操作的基础。下面将详细介绍这一过程以及其他关键步骤。
一、安装Python
Python作为一种通用的编程语言,广泛应用于数据分析、Web开发、自动化运维等领域。安装Python是设置Linux系统的首要任务。
1.1、使用包管理器安装Python
大多数Linux发行版都预装了Python,但通常版本较旧。可以通过包管理器安装最新版本。例如,在Debian系(如Ubuntu)上,可以使用以下命令:
sudo apt update
sudo apt install python3
在Red Hat系(如CentOS)上,可以使用:
sudo yum install python3
1.2、从源码编译安装Python
有时需要特定版本的Python,这时可以从源码编译安装。首先,下载源码:
wget https://www.python.org/ftp/python/3.x.x/Python-3.x.x.tgz
tar -xvf Python-3.x.x.tgz
cd Python-3.x.x
然后,配置并安装:
./configure --enable-optimizations
make
sudo make altinstall
注意:使用make altinstall而不是make install,以避免覆盖系统默认Python版本。
二、配置环境变量
配置环境变量有助于简化命令行操作,特别是在多版本Python共存的情况下。
2.1、设置PYTHONPATH
编辑~/.bashrc或~/.bash_profile文件,添加以下内容:
export PYTHONPATH="/usr/local/lib/python3.x/site-packages"
export PATH="/usr/local/bin:$PATH"
然后,运行以下命令使配置生效:
source ~/.bashrc
三、安装必备库
Python的强大之处在于其丰富的第三方库。使用pip安装常用库是必不可少的步骤。
3.1、安装pip
大多数Python发行版都会自带pip。如果没有,可以通过以下命令安装:
sudo apt install python3-pip
或者:
sudo yum install python3-pip
3.2、安装常用库
使用pip安装常用库,例如:
pip3 install numpy pandas matplotlib
四、设置虚拟环境
虚拟环境可以隔离不同项目的依赖,避免库版本冲突。
4.1、安装virtualenv
使用pip安装virtualenv:
pip3 install virtualenv
4.2、创建和激活虚拟环境
创建虚拟环境:
virtualenv venv
激活虚拟环境:
source venv/bin/activate
在虚拟环境中,可以安装项目所需的库,而不影响系统全局环境。
五、创建和管理Python脚本
在完成以上步骤后,可以开始创建和管理Python脚本。
5.1、编写简单脚本
创建一个名为hello.py的文件,写入以下内容:
print("Hello, World!")
5.2、运行脚本
在终端中,导航到脚本所在目录,并运行:
python3 hello.py
六、项目管理系统推荐
在进行Python项目管理时,选择合适的项目管理系统至关重要。推荐使用研发项目管理系统PingCode和通用项目管理软件Worktile,两者都能有效提升项目管理效率。
6.1、PingCode
PingCode是一款专为研发团队设计的项目管理系统,支持多种开发流程,提供全面的需求管理、缺陷管理、任务管理等功能。适合复杂项目和大型团队。
6.2、Worktile
Worktile是一款通用项目管理软件,支持任务分配、进度跟踪、团队协作等功能。界面简洁,易于上手,适合中小型团队和个人项目管理。
总结
通过以上步骤,您可以在Linux系统上成功设置Python环境,从而高效地进行Python开发和项目管理。安装Python、配置环境变量、安装必备库、设置虚拟环境、创建和管理Python脚本是设置过程中的关键步骤。选择合适的项目管理系统,如PingCode和Worktile,能够进一步提升项目管理效率。希望这篇文章对您有所帮助,祝您在Python开发之路上取得成功。
相关问答FAQs:
1. 如何在Linux系统上安装Python?
- 在Linux系统上安装Python非常简单。你可以通过以下步骤完成安装:
- 打开终端,输入以下命令:
sudo apt-get update,更新软件包列表。 - 输入命令:
sudo apt-get install python3,安装Python3。 - 输入命令:
python3 --version,检查Python版本是否正确安装。
- 打开终端,输入以下命令:
2. 如何在Linux系统上设置Python环境变量?
- 如果你希望在终端中直接使用Python命令,可以将Python的可执行文件路径添加到环境变量中。以下是设置Python环境变量的步骤:
- 打开终端,输入以下命令:
sudo nano ~/.bashrc,打开bashrc文件。 - 在文件末尾添加以下行:
export PATH="/usr/local/bin/python3:$PATH",其中/usr/local/bin/python3是Python的可执行文件路径。 - 按下Ctrl + X,然后按下Y保存并退出。
- 输入命令:
source ~/.bashrc,使修改立即生效。 - 输入命令:
python3,检查Python命令是否可以正常使用。
- 打开终端,输入以下命令:
3. 如何在Linux系统上安装Python的第三方库?
- 在Linux系统上安装Python的第三方库非常简单。以下是安装Python第三方库的步骤:
- 打开终端,输入以下命令:
pip3 install 库名,其中库名是你想要安装的库的名称。 - 等待安装完成,你就可以在你的Python脚本中导入并使用这个库了。如果你不确定要安装的库的名称,可以在网上搜索相关文档或使用
pip3 search 关键词来查找可用的库。
- 打开终端,输入以下命令:
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/731604